Amendment102nd Congress
An en bloc amendment consisting of two amendments which would: 1) Establish a drug testing program as a precondition for civilian employment in the U.S. Coast Guard and 2) establish a continuing program of random drug testing for all civilian Coast Guard employees.

- Purpose
- Amendments were offered en bloc and the question was divided in order to have separate roll calls on each part. \ Roll Call 215 was on agreeing to the first part of the amendment which sought to require preemployment drug testing for any person hired for a civilian position by the Coast Guard. See item numbered 553. \ Roll Call 216 was on agreeing to the second part of the amendment which sought to require the random drug testing of civilian employees of the Coast Guard. See item numbered 554.
